The National Hydro-Meteorological Forecasting Centre has issued a warning over extreme weather conditions in Vietnam’s northern and north-eastern provinces. In an urgent official note, the ministries of national defence, public security, transport, industry and trade have been advised to implement immediate prevention measures in preparation for the anticipated heavy rains, which are likely to trigger flashfloods and landslides. The affected provinces are Cao Bang, Lang Son, Tuyen Quang, Ha Giang, Lao Cai, Yen Bai, Lai Chau, Dien Bien, Son La and Bac Kan. Vietnam is highly prone to extreme weather, with the country now in the middle of the south-west monsoon season.
